    The problem

    Financial infrastructure is still sold in the dark.

    Almost every BaaS, OFaaS, payment processing, or gateway provider builds custom proposals and charges each client a different price. Without a public benchmark, those receiving a proposal have little basis for negotiating — and those sending one have little basis for pricing with confidence.

    Smaller fintechs pay the highest price: they accept whatever comes because they have nothing to compare it to. In some cases, the markup makes the business unviable before the product even ships.

    On the other side of the table, sales teams overcharge out of uncertainty or undercharge out of fear of losing the deal — with no clear read on where the market actually sits.

    Data & transparency

    Radical transparency. Including our own.

    150+

    Products mapped

    Pix, Open Finance, CCBs, and KYC — the main cost categories of Brazilian financial infrastructure.

    650+

    Data points

    Real proposals collected over time, with historical coverage of prices actually charged in the market.

    Anonymized

    Proposals voluntarily provided by companies in the ecosystem or gathered by Cumbuca in prior periods. Commercial proposals received by Cumbuca Instituição de Pagamento Ltda. as a client in the 6 (six) months preceding the date of consultation are excluded.

    Continuous improvement

    Every new proposal submitted to the tool contributes to the continuous improvement of the categorization and pricing engines.
